Problems Running Iomega Jaz Tools

SYMPTOMS

When Iomega Tools for Windows 95 is installed on your computer, your computer may stop responding (hang), or you may receive an error message referencing the Iomega.vxd file, when you attempt to use the Iomega Jaz tools.

Back to the top

CAUSE

You may be using a version of Iomega Jaz tools earlier than Iomega Tools for Windows 95 version 5.0. Earlier versions are not compatible with Windows 95 OEM Service Release 2 (OSR2).

Back to the top

RESOLUTION

Uninstall the Iomega Tools for Windows 95.
Contact Iomega to inquire about obtaining version 5.0 or later of Iomega Tools. Version 5.0 of Iomega Tools is FAT32 File System-aware.
